在本文中,我们将探讨Shadowsocks,一种常用的代理软件,其作用是帮助用户更安全地连接互联网,实现科学上网。本文将介绍Shadowsocks的定义、工作原理、安装步骤、常见问题等内容。
Shadowsocks是什么
Shadowsocks 是一种基于Socks5代理协议的网络代理工具,其目的是帮助用户绕过网络审查和实现科学上网。它通过代理服务器中转网络请求,以保护用户的隐私并提供更安全的网络访问。Shadowsocks使用加密算法对传输的数据进行加密,使得传输过程中的数据更加安全。
Shadowsocks的工作原理
Shadowsocks的工作原理比较简单,其核心在于代理服务器。用户需要在自己的设备上安装Shadowsocks客户端,并配置好相应的参数,然后连接到远程的Shadowsocks代理服务器。当用户需要访问被墙的网站或服务时,用户的网络请求会先经过Shadowsocks客户端,然后由代理服务器转发请求并接收响应,最终将响应返回给用户。
如何安装Shadowsocks
安装Shadowsocks需要分为客户端和服务器端的安装步骤。
客户端安装步骤
-
Windows
- 下载Shadowsocks客户端安装程序(如Shadowsocks-4.0.6.exe);
- 运行安装程序,按照提示逐步完成安装;
- 启动Shadowsocks客户端,填写相应的服务器信息和端口,点击连接即可使用。
-
MacOS
- 使用Homebrew安装Shadowsocks-libev;
- 配置Shadowsocks客户端,填写服务器信息和端口,启动即可连接。
-
Linux
- 通过命令行安装Shadowsocks-qt5;
- 运行安装命令并配置服务器信息,启动Shadowsocks即可使用。
-
Android
- 从应用商店下载并安装Shadowsocks应用;
- 打开应用,填写服务器信息和端口,启动连接即可使用。
-
iOS
- 从App Store下载并安装Shadowsocks应用;
- 打开应用,配置服务器信息和端口,连接到服务器即可使用。
服务器端安装步骤
- 用户需要拥有一台境外服务器,例如使用国外的云服务器;
- 在境外服务器上安装Shadowsocks服务器端,具体安装方法可以参考相关教程,如使用命令行安装。
Shadowsocks的常见问题
为什么我无法连接到Shadowsocks服务器?
- 可能是服务器地址或端口填写错误,检查配置信息是否正确;
- 也有可能是服务器端出现故障,联系服务器管理员或者检查服务器状态。
我的网络速度在使用Shadowsocks时变慢了,怎么办?
- 可能是服务器负载较高,可以尝试切换到其他服务器;
- 也有可能是本地网络环境问题,尝试重启路由器或更换网络环境。
Shadowsocks是否合法?
- 在某些国家和地区,使用Shadowsocks可能违反当地法律法规,请遵守当地法律;
- 一些云服务商也禁止用户在其服务器上使用Shadowsocks等代理软件,请确认使用协议是否符合相关规定。”,”FAQ”:”## 常见问题FAQ
如何使用Shadowsocks进行科学上网?
要使用Shadowsocks进行科学上网,您需要按照以下步骤操作:
- 安装Shadowsocks客户端,并配置服务器信息;
- 启动Shadowsocks客户端,连接到服务器;
- 打开浏览器或其他应用程序,开始正常的网络访问。
Shadowsocks有哪些优势?
Shadowsocks相比其他代理工具具有以下优势:
- 加密传输:Shadowsocks使用加密算法对传输的数据进行加密,更加安全;
- 穿透能力强:Shadowsocks能够有效地穿透防火墙,让用户更容易访问被封锁的网站和服务;
- 灵活性:用户可以自由选择不同的代理服务器,以获得更好的使用体验。
如何解决Shadowsocks连接问题?
如果遇到连接问题,您可以尝试以下解决方法:
- 检查服务器地址和端口是否填写正确;
- 尝试切换到其他可用的代理服务器;
- 如果是服务器端故障,联系服务器管理员或更换服务器。
Shadowsocks是否合法?
对于Shadowsocks的合法性问题,需要根据具体的国家和地区的法律法规来判断。在某些地区,使用Shadowsocks可能会违反法律法规,请用户在使用前务必了解当地相关法律法规。
正文完